Ryan Gaydosh Bio

Ryan Gaydosh is a dedicated law enforcement professional with over 15 years of experience, specializing in firearms instruction, CQB tactics, sniper operations, and explosive breaching. Known for his leadership and expertise, Ryan has significantly contributed to advancing tactical operations and officer training throughout his career.

Professional Experience

  • Kent Police Department (2011–Present)

    • Current Rank: Lieutenant
    • Firearms and CQB Tactics Instructor
  • Macedonia Police Department (2009–2011)

  • Metro SWAT (2014–Present)

    • Assistant Commander (2021–Present)
    • Team Leader (2019–2021)
    • Member since 2014
    • Oversees Sniper Group Operations
  • Ohio Tactical Officers Association (OTOA)

    • Member of the OTOA R.E.D. (Response, Education, Development) Team Training Cadre (Since 2022)

Specialized Training

  • Sniper Training
    • Completed Basic Sniper through OTOA
  • Explosive Breaching
    • Certified in Basic and Advanced Explosive Breaching through TEES (Tactical Energetic Entry Systems)
